Naija
Alternative forms
- coconut wota
Etymology
Borrowed from English coconut water
Pronunciation
- kòkònɔ́t wɔ̀tá

Definition
- water wey sempe for inside coconut.
Noun
coconut water: water gotten from coconut fruit
- Egbokhare (frequency:Inf)
- No drink coconut water. E dey make person no know book. — (Do not drink coconut water because it makes someone to be unintelligent.)
Derived forms
- coconut oil, coconut rice, coconut candle
Translations
- English: water gotten from coconut fruit
